Lot #791 - BRITISH COMMONWEALTH SOUTH AFRICA - Orange River Colony
1868 1sh orange, horizontal bisect used as 6p, tied to 1868 cover by barred oval cancel, Cape of Good Hope 4p blue also tied at right, Colesberg backstamp, Somerset arrival on front, addressee's name excised. As per regulations, cover to the Cape, had to have 6p in Free State and 4p in Cape postage.
